I can help you. There are only two hardwood supplies on Long Island.
1) Woodply, in Freeport. Plywood, hardwood, exotics, over 80 species in stock. www.woodply.com
2) J&A Lumber Co., 2050 Fifth Ave. Ronkonkoma. Hardwood with some exotics. 631 585 5057
